Amazon Fire TV Stick 4K Max (2023) Review: Amazon's Best Streamer Picks Up New Tricks
www.cnet.com
The Amazon Fire TV Stick 4K Max (2nd Gen) is a great option for those looking for an affordable streaming device with 4K Ultra HD and Dolby Vision support. It offers tight integration with Amazon products and features the Alexa voice assistant. The new Max model has a slightly faster processor, upgraded Wi-Fi, and double the memory compared to its predecessor. The standout feature is the new Ambient mode, which includes widgets for weather, calendar, live TV, music, smart home, and more. The Fire TV interface has also been updated with a dock-like appearance. The remote is not the best, but it includes voice commands. Overall, the Max is a solid streaming option, although the Roku Streaming Stick 4K still offers better value for the money.

Attribute | Amazon Fire TV Stick 4K | Apple TV 4K 128GB (2022) |
---|---|---|
Bluetooth | 5 | 5 |
Height | 30 mm | 93 mm |
Thickness | 14 mm | 31 mm |
Volume | 45.36 cm³ | 268.119 cm³ |
Dolby Vision Display | True | True |
HDR10+ Display | True | True |
Voice Commands | True | True |
Built-in Smart TV | True | True |
Dolby Atmos | True | True |
Ad-Free | False | True |
Airplay | False | True |
HLG | True | True |
Chromecast | False | False |
Compatible with Google Assistant | False | False |
Compatible with Alexa | True | False |
Compatible with Siri | False | True |
Dolby Audio | True | True |
Dolby Digital | True | True |
Dolby Digital Plus | True | True |
HDR10 Display | True | True |
Output Resolution | 4K | 4K |
Refresh Rate | 60Hz | 60Hz |
Total Clock Speed | 6.8 GHz | 14.4 GHz |
GPU Clock Speed | 650 MHz | 1200 MHz |
RAM | 1.5GB (not listed for Apple TV) | (not listed for Amazon) |
Internal Storage | 8GB | 128GB |
HDMI Version | HDMI 2.0 | HDMI 2.1 |
WiFi | WiFi 5 | WiFi 6, WiFi 5 |
HDMI ARC | None | eARC |
External Memory Slot | False | False |
RJ45 Ports | 0 | 1 |
USB Ports | 0 | 0 |
USB Type C | False | False |
Rechargeable Remote | False | True |
Customizable Remote | False | False |
Remote Control | True | True |
Remote Headphone Jack | False | False |
Warranty Time | 1 year | (not listed for Apple TV) |
Width | 108 mm | 93 mm |
The Amazon Fire TV Stick 4K offers a compact design with robust streaming capabilities, supporting 4K with Dolby Vision and HDR10+. It features Alexa integration, 1.5GB RAM, and is priced affordably at under $50. In contrast, the Apple TV 4K 128GB (2022) provides higher performance with 128GB storage, WiFi 6 compatibility, and a more extensive ecosystem with Airplay and Siri support. It also includes a rechargeable remote and HDMI 2.1 with eARC support.
Amazon Fire TV Stick 4K: Ideal for budget-conscious users seeking solid 4K streaming with Alexa integration and a straightforward setup.
Apple TV 4K 128GB (2022): Suitable for users invested in the Apple ecosystem, needing extensive storage, advanced connectivity options like WiFi 6 and Airplay, and Siri voice control for seamless integration with other Apple devices.
These recommendations consider the specific needs of users looking for either budget-friendly streaming solutions or integrated experiences within the Apple ecosystem.
